Chimchar @ Focus Sash
Ability: Blaze
Hasty 4 HP 132 Atk 4 Def 188 Spe 132 SpA 4 SpD
~ Fake Out
~ Counter
~ Stealth Rock
~ Overheat
Fake Out is self explanitory, and Focus Sash lets it always get the job done with SR. Counter also works well with Sash and can be used if SR is already on the field. Sash also complements its last move, Overheat, by activating Blaze. Overheat with Blaze melts anything that does not resist it, and then some.

Wailmer @ Choice Scarf
Ability: Water Veil
Rash 116 HP 196 Spe 196 SpA
~ Water Spout
~ Ice Beam
~ Hidden Power Electric
~ Selfdestruct / Surf
Choice Scarf + Water Spout = Pwnage. HP Electric is for Water types, notabaly Mantyke. Wailmer has no potential when SR is up so Selfdestrust is the best attack then. Wailmer really has no problem with anything except Chinchou, which absorbs HP and resists the other moves.

Teddiursa @ Toxic Orb
Ability: Quick Feet
Adamant 196 Atk 116 Def 196 Spe
~ Facade
~ Close Combat
~ Fire Punch / Protect
~ Shadow Claw
Teddiursa has amazing coverage and speed after Toxic Orb. Facade will dent everything that isn't imune, in which Shadow Claw OHKOs. Teddiursa has every single bit of potentail it needs. I mainly switch it out to revenge kill before Toxic Orb is activated to activate it, but it can also come in on ghost attacks and hit back with Shadow Claw. If you can find the time to activate Toxic Orb, its be worth your while. I replaced Fire Punch with Protect to safly activate Toxic Orb, while keeping an amazingly strong STAB and fighting/ghost coverage.

Machop @ Leftovers
Ability: Guts / No Guard
Adamant 196 HP 196 Atk 78 Spe
~ Rest
~ Sleep Talk
~ Cross Chop / Facade / DynamicPunch
~ Payback
Status absorbing Machop. I chose Guts over DynamicPunch because the attack boost is more usefull than the loss of confusion. When factoring in STAB and status, Cross Chop will have a power of 150 and Facade will follow closely with 140. I use Cross Chop, but if you prefer accuracy over that small power boost and higher critical hit ratio, facade is your poison. I opend my mind to DynamicPunch and it was a better choice. No Guard goes with out saying when using DynamicPunch.

Dratini @ Life Orb
Ability: Shed Skin
Adamant 28 HP 224 Atk 36 SpD 196 Spe
~ Dragon Dance
~ Outrage
~ Waterfall
~ Extremespeed
My second and only smogon set. I switch in on something that it resists, DD, and procede to win. Just like it's "OU Clone" Gyarados, it can Check Mate after 2 DD's. Extremespeed pwns other priority moves after a DD or two and the rest are for coverage. Don't use outrage on something that resists it, because you can't switch after. Even thought Shed Skin stops status from stopping you, don't abuse it and DD because the LifeOrb damage together with status will bring you to your downfall.
~ Smogon's "Dragon Dance" set.
